Bantayan's Virgin Island

It is an island destination within an island destination. Virgin Island is just about 20 twenty minutes boat ride from Bantayan Island. Although Bantayan Island is already a destination in itself and you can practically have its beaches all to yourself, still, if you want isolation and solace, then you may head to charming Virgin Island.

Virgin Island boasts of pure white sand beach in a cove-like surrounding so there ain't no strong winds. It is privately owned and they have strict laws about the cleanliness of the island. There are no restaurants or store there so you have to bring some for your consumption. There is an entrance fee, however of P300 per person to be paid to the care-taker of the island.

Before I forget, the water surrounding the island is said to be shark infested but the caretaker said that only minimal bites were reported. When I asked what minimal means, she said I better dip in the beach and experience it for myself. Hmmmmm. Here are some pics...
